1. Cover Critical Auto Repairs
One common way people use a car title loan is to pay for important automotive repairs. Many people may not think you would be able to because you use the car’s lien-free title to secure the loan. Wouldn’t a loan provider not give out a loan to someone with a damaged car?
The vehicle itself is not used as collateral for the instant title loan; the car title is. You can use the vehicle title for a car that needs repairs to secure emergency money. The condition of your car could affect the loan amount, but you can still get the car title loan and drive your car to the mechanic for auto repairs.

How Much Money Can You Get With An Instant Title Loan?
An instant title loan can be helpful, but you must understand it’s not a one-size-fits-all solution. Depending on your car's worth, you could qualify for between $300 and $15,00. A knowledgeable representative will inspect your car as part of the process to determine how much you qualify to borrow.
During the inspection, they will determine the value of your vehicle based on the year, make, model, mileage, and vehicle condition.
